The street in brief

Frogmoor Lane is a mix of semi-detached houses and flats. Homes here typically change hands around £451,250 — roughly 25% below the WD3 norm. On floor area that works out near £6,477 per square metre, above the district's £6,150.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across WD3 prices have been easing over the last few years. With 10 sales across 7 homes since 2003, homes here come to market only rarely.

Frogmoor Lane's £451,250 median sits about 25% below WD3's £605,000; on floor space it runs £6,477/m² against the district's £6,150/m² (+5%).

Street and WD3 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
